“Indiana Jones: The Dial of Destiny” – A Swashbuckling Sign-Off for Harrison Ford

Indiana Jones: The Dial of Destiny brings a sense of nostalgia to fans who have followed the famed archaeologist’s adventures over the years. This highly anticipated fifth installment, directed by James Mangold, marks the end of an era as Harrison Ford bids farewell to his iconic role as Indiana Jones. Stepping down from the director’s chair, Steven Spielberg passes the torch to Mangold, who delivers a film that pays homage to the franchise’s roots while introducing new elements.

Indiana Jones: The Dial of Destiny

The film begins with a thrilling flashback to Indy’s younger days battling Nazis in search of a powerful artifact, the Antikythera Dial. The story then quickly moves to 1969, where we find our aging protagonist, now a professor on the verge of retirement, waking up in his New York apartment.

While the film initially struggles to captivate audiences, it makes progress with the introduction of Indy’s granddaughter Helena, played by the talented Phoebe Waller-Bridge. Helena’s spirited character sets the stage for a new discovery, as she inspires Indy to rediscover the spark of adventure he once had. The dynamic between Ford’s raucous, hot-tempered Indy and Waller-Bridge’s witty, sharp-tongued Helena brings a refreshing chemistry to the screen, adding to the film’s appeal.

Mangold may not have the dynamic brilliance of Spielberg, but his direction shows off Ford’s prowess in a series of thrilling action sequences. From horse riding to thrilling tuk-tuk chases, Ford’s performances continue to impress. However, some viewers may notice an increased reliance on CGI as a departure from the practical stunts that defined the previous films.

Despite these minor flaws, Indiana Jones and the Dial of Destiny evokes the nostalgia that fans have cherished since the franchise’s inception. For those who have followed Indy’s adventures through all four previous films or even just one or two, this long-awaited final installment brings a fitting conclusion to the beloved character’s journey.
